How to fill out Reply Brief of Relator

01
Begin by stating the court's case number and title on the first page.
02
Include a table of contents and a table of authorities, if required.
03
Clearly articulate the purpose of the Reply Brief, addressing the counterarguments made in the opposition.
04
Organize the body of the Reply Brief systematically, outlining each point you wish to rebut.
05
Provide citations to relevant legal precedents or statutes to support your arguments.
06
Conclude with a strong summarization of your position, reiterating why the relief sought should be granted.
07
Review and edit the document for clarity and conciseness before submission.
08
Ensure the brief complies with all relevant formatting and procedural rules as specified by the court.

The Reply Brief of Relator is a legal document filed in appellate courts where the relator responds to arguments presented by the opposing party in their previous briefs. It typically addresses specific points of contention to clarify the relator's position.
The relator, who is the party that initiated the case or appealing party, is required to file the Reply Brief of Relator to counter the arguments raised by the opposing party.
To fill out the Reply Brief of Relator, the relator must include a heading indicating the court and case number, a statement of facts, responses to each argument laid out by the opposing party, and a conclusion restating the reasons why the court should rule in their favor.
The purpose of the Reply Brief of Relator is to provide an opportunity for the relator to respond to the opposition's arguments, clarify their legal position, and persuade the court to decide in their favor by addressing key issues raised against them.
The Reply Brief of Relator must report the relator's responses to the opposition's points, relevant legal arguments, citations to case law or statutes, and any additional evidence or facts that support the relator's position.
